About Liguo Yao
Liguo Yao is a scholar working on Artificial Intelligence, Industrial and Manufacturing Engineering, Computational Theory and Mathematics, Computer Vision and Pattern Recognition and Control and Systems Engineering, having authored 35 papers that have together received 1.0k indexed citations. Recurring topics across this work include Metaheuristic Optimization Algorithms Research (10 papers), Industrial Vision Systems and Defect Detection (7 papers), Advanced Multi-Objective Optimization Algorithms (6 papers), Manufacturing Process and Optimization (5 papers), Evolutionary Algorithms and Applications (5 papers), Natural Language Processing Techniques (4 papers), Imbalanced Data Classification Techniques (4 papers) and Topic Modeling (4 papers). The work is most often cited by research in Industrial and Manufacturing Engineering (208 citations), Artificial Intelligence (438 citations), Computer Vision and Pattern Recognition (234 citations), Control and Systems Engineering (217 citations) and Computational Theory and Mathematics (93 citations). Liguo Yao has collaborated with scholars based in China, Taiwan and Malaysia. Frequent co-authors include Haisong Huang, Qingsong Fan, Dong Huang, Qipeng Chen, Jianan Wei, Qingsheng Xie, Yiting Li, Yao Lu, Yao Hu and Chieh-Yuan Tsai. Their work appears in journals such as Expert Systems with Applications, Applied Sciences, Engineering Applications of Artificial Intelligence, Journal of Computational Design and Engineering and Knowledge-Based Systems.
